❍ 12. Assemble the two aileron pushrods made from two
200mm wire pushrods, clevises, and silicone retainers.
To make the pushrods, thread the clevises onto the wire
pushrods approximately 25 full turns.
❍ 13. Center the servo arm on the servo. Attach the clevis to
the torque rod horn; hold the aileron level with the bottom of
the wing, using a straight edge to assure accuracy. Mark the
location where the wire crosses the hole in the servo arm. At
this location bend the wire 90 degrees.
❍ 14. After bending the pushrods at your mark, slide the
Faslink over the wire and snap it into place on the pushrod.
❍ Cut the wire that extends beyond the Faslink; be certain
to leave 1/16” [1.6mm] of wire protruding from the Faslink
as shown in the photograph.
❍ 15. Install the remaining pushrod in the same manner.
The above photo shows how your assembly should look
when finished.
